The Signs Your Pipes Need Relining

If you’re unsure whether or not your pipes need relining, here are a few signs to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• Gurgling noises co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Should I Have My Pipe Relined or Replaced?

This is a concern that homeowners from all walks of life will have to be asked at time. Both relining and replacement come with their advantages and disadvantages. It can be difficult to determine what is best for you. Here are a few concerns to keep in mind:

Relining

  • Relining is cheaper than replacement.
  • It’s possible without tearing your floors or walls.
  • It can be done quickly typically in a day or two.
  • There’s less mess to make after the project has been completed.
  • The new liner will last for a long time.

Replacement

  • Replacement is more expensive than replacing.
  • It’s not a clean job, and you may need to leave your home for a couple of days as it is being done.
  • The new pipe will last for a long time.

Approximately, How Long Will Pipe Relining Last?

One of the greatest benefits of sliplining technology is that it is able to last for a long time. In actual fact, it is not uncommon for pipe relining to last for up to 50 years. This is a major improvement over conventional methods such as excavation, which typically last 10 to 15 years.

Sliplining pipes within Woolloomooloo is also a more cost-effective option over the long term. Not only does it last longer and lasts longer, but it’s more affordable than conventional methods. This is due to the fact that there’s no require for expensive equipment or human resources, but only the help of a certified plumber who has the proper tools.

Can You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

The trenchless pipe relining process is an excellent, no-dig method of fixing broken pipes with bends within them. The pipe relining process creates a new pipe within an existing pipeline. This means you don’t have to remove the old pipe, and you are able to repair it without having to dig into your driveway or yard.

The difficultness of a pipe relining project gets more difficult with more bends in the pipe. Our team of experts has repaired many sewer line pipes that have bends.

While this is challenging, it’s not impossible and we have the expertise and expertise to get the job completed right.

Can Sliplining Stop Tree Roots From Entering Drainage System?

Yes, trenchless pipe relining solutions could help in stopping tree roots from getting into your sewer. Sliplining is the process of creating a new pipe inside the old one, which helps to close any cracks or openings that might allow tree roots to enter.

In addition, regular maintenance and cleaning of your sewer system could assist in stopping tree roots from entering.

Can Collapsed Pipes Be Relined?

We cannot reline pipes that have collapsed. If you have a collapsed pipe it is likely that you’ll need repair of the pipe completely. If you’re unsure what the damage is to your pipe, we can come out and perform an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Reduce Pipe Flow?

There is generally no change in pipe flow because of pipe relining. In fact, pipe relining can increase how much water flows that flows through the pipe since it creates a new, smooth surface for water through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been An Option?

Pipe relining has been utilised for a long time, and the first time it was documented being in 1854. However, it wasn’t until the early 2000s that it started to be more commonly used.

The technology of pipe relining is widely used around the world as an efficient solution to fix leaks or damaged pipes, without having to remove them and replace them completely. There are various kinds of pipe relining solutions that can be employed in accordance with the type of pipe and the extent of what the issue is.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ining Woolloomooloo, which is used for small leaks, and structural pipe relining, that is utilised for more severe damage. Whichever type of pipe relining used in the process, the goal is the same: to repair the pipe without having to replace it entirely.

This no dig option will reduce time and cost and it’s also a more environmentally friendly option than replacing the pipe.
